Joe Diffie to Record Live Album

Joe Diffie will record a live album Friday night at “The World’s Largest Honky Tonk,” Billy Bob’s Texas. He joins a long list of artists to make a live recording at the venue, following in the footsteps of musicians such as Willie Nelson and Merle Haggard.
 
"I have always wanted to record a live album but wanted to do it right," Diffie said. "Some of my favorite musical heroes, Willie and Haggard, taped live albums at Billy Bob's so it's a career highlight to record my live album in the same venue. I couldn't think of a better place."
 
Diffie recently scored a No. 1 hit overseas with the song “Long Gone Loner.” The single is a duet with reigning European Artist of the Year, Peter & the Rowers and has reached the top spot on the ECMA Top 100 chart.
